Trieste is a swissdesigned, italianbuilt deep diving research bathyscaphe which reached a record depth of about 10,911 metres 35,797 ft in the challenger deep of the mariana trench near guam in the pacific. Over the last few decades, engineers have developed submersible technologies capable of meeting the many challenges that the deep sea imposes upon explorers, allowing us to dive to depths where utter darkness, crushing pressures, and extreme cold temperatures prohibit scuba operations. To scientists, the deep sea is the lowest part of the ocean, below the thermocline the layer where heating and cooling from sunlight ceases to have an effect and above the sea floor.
